I'm referring to the package "wine64-staging", which is on master.  I
may have been confused myself at the time I mentioned this in #guix,
but now I have tested this a bit more thoroughly.

For one, I've historically been using wine64, since (at least on Guix)
it works with both 32bit and 64bit software and I sometimes stumble
upon the latter.  As a result, I have a 64bit wine prefix and using
wine (or wine-staging) does not really work well with that.  I was able
to determine that plain wine is unaffected by running the same commands
on a machine with no existing prefix.  (Note, that regular wine64 still
fails with a fresh prefix.)  My experiments with wine64-staging were
solely meant as a way of finding the point at which wine64 fails, I
have no intent of actually using it for more than that.
I'm not quite sure, what exactly is at fault here.  It could be
upstream, or it could be the magic that we use to merge 32 and 64 bit
wine.

TL;DR: The affected packages are wine64 and wine64-staging, the latter
of which is broken beyond 5.8 (though 5.9 would work as well).  Since
this affects the 64bit version of wine specifically, we either have to
fix something in our build (not sure what) or desync wine and wine64
(same with -staging variants)
